NORTH DIVISION DIVISION   OVERALL
(Final 2003-04) W L Pct.   W L Pct.
Daemen*+ 11 3 .786   24 10 .706
Seton Hill 9 5 .643   18 8 .692
Saint Vincent# 8 6 .571   25 7 .781
Roberts Wesleyan 8 6 .571   14 16 .467
Geneva 7 7 .500   16 14 .533
Point Park 5 9 .357   14 13 .519
Houghton 5 9 .357   8 18 .308
Notre Dame 3 11 .214   8 22 .267
               
SOUTH DIVISION DIVISION   OVERALL
(Final 2003-04) W L Pct.   W L Pct.
Cedarville* 15 3 .833   27 9 .750
Mount Vernon Nazarene 13 5 .722   23 13 .639
Rio Grande 13 5 .722   20 11 .645
Ohio Dominican 11 7 .611   19 16 .543
Shawnee State 11 7 .611   15 16 .484
Malone 8 10 .444   16 14 .533
Tiffin 7 11 .389   9 18 .333
Walsh 5 13 .278   11 19 .367
Urbana 4 14 .222   7 24 .226
Wilberforce 3 15 .167   5 27 .156
 
+ AMC Championship Game Winner
# AMC/NAIA Qualifying Tournament Champion
* Division Champions
Records include the following forfeits:
  from Berry GA to Cedarville and Seton Hill;
  from Geneva to Penn State-Beaver, Roberts Wesleyan, and Seton Hill
  from Warner Southern to Walsh

North Player of the Year
Darnell Jackson, Daemen

North Coach of the Year
Don Silveri, Daemen

North Freshman of the Year
Ian McCollough, Saint Vincent

South Player of the Year
Delano Thomas, Shawnee State

South Coach of the Year
Ray Slagle, Cedarville

South Freshman of the Year
Mark Hess, Mount Vernon Nazarene

Ron Holmes Award
Dave Hilborn, Notre Dame
